Medical Incident Technician
The Medical Incident Technician (MIT) is a provider that works within a unified command system in an austere environment and has access to communications and supporting infrastructure to manage a patient. This is still within the realm of wilderness medicine because the incidents occur far enough away from advanced medical care that field management is necessary. Medical Incident Technicians will be proficient in communications to bring in the resources needed to manage a casualty, as well as stabilizing an injured or sick patient. All variations of MIT follow the same core, switching out scenarios and simulations to more accurately prepare the providers for incidents they are likely to encounter in their jobs.
